About The Position

SUMMARY: The Production Engineer I plays a pivotal role in overseeing the manufacturing process to ensure high-quality work is completed safely and efficiently. This role involves liaising with other engineers to develop plans that enhance product quality, reduce costs, and improve process reliability. The Production Engineer I will support production operations, troubleshoot issues, and drive continuous improvement initiatives within the manufacturing process. ESSENTIAL DUTIES AND RESPONSIBILITIES: Ensure production drawings and documentation are accurate and up-to-date, adhering to proper revision control and engineering practices. Monitor the manufacturing process to ensure compliance with safety and quality standards. Troubleshoot electromechanical problems and assist production with issues arising from design or supplier errors. Provide technical support to production teams to resolve on-the-floor issues. Assist the purchasing department in sourcing replacement components and working with outside vendors to resolve quality issues. Order samples and expedite components for evaluation, ensuring timely delivery and quality. Participate in the research and compilation of technical information related to component selection and vendor sourcing. Evaluate new components and materials to support product development and production needs. Lead training sessions for production employees on topics such as soldering, crimping, as well as assisting with cross-training initiatives in different production cells. Develop and implement training materials to enhance the skills of production personnel. Support the transition of products from engineering to production, including inventory transfer and review of assembly drawings and manuals. Initiate and facilitate continuous process improvement by analyzing new and existing production procedures. Maximize the concepts of lean manufacturing to enhance efficiency and reduce waste. Drive initiatives for continuous process improvement, focusing on enhancing efficiency, quality, and cost-effectiveness. Collaborate with cross-functional teams to identify and implement best practices in manufacturing. Perform other duties as assigned.

Requirements

  • Associate’s Degree or equivalent work experience with electronic and mechanical design required
  • Strong technical problem-solving skills with the ability to troubleshoot electronic assemblies.
  • Proficient in reading schematics and performing basic electronic troubleshooting.
  • Ability to solder and work with electronic components.
  • Experience with engineering drawings and specifications of electrical/mechanical parts.
  • Working knowledge of CAD software, Epicor or related MRP/ERP systems, and general MS Windows applications.
  • Excellent communication and interpersonal skills, with the ability to work effectively in a team environment.
  • Strong organizational skills and attention to detail.
  • Commitment to continuous improvement and lean manufacturing principles.
